Zelienople Borough Council does hereby adopt as the Building
Code, Electrical Code, Plumbing Code, Mechanical Code and Property
Maintenance Code of Zelienople Borough the 1993 BOCA National Building
Code, the 1999 National Electrical Code, the 1993 BOCA National Plumbing
Code, the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code, Appendix C
of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code, Appendix F of
the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code, the 1993 BOCA National
Property Maintenance Code and the 1993 BOCA Mechanical Code for the
regulation of the construction, erection, fabrication, enlargement,
alteration, maintenance and conditions, substantial repair, plumbing,
electrical and mechanical installations of properties, and structures
within the Borough of Zelienople, including amendments to said Building
Code, Plumbing Code, Electrical Code, Property Maintenance Code or
Mechanical Code as may be made from time to time. The said 1993 BOCA
National Building Code, the 1999 National Electrical Code, the 1993
BOCA National Plumbing Code, the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ling
Code, Appendix C of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code,
Appendix F of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code, the
1993 BOCA National Property Maintenance Code and the 1993 BOCA Mechanical
Code is incorporated herein by reference as if more fully set forth,
including such amendments as may from time to time be made.
The following sections of the various codes are hereby deleted
in their entirety, to wit:
A. 1993 BOCA National Building Code: Section 121.0 Means of Appeal.
B. 1993 BOCA National Plumbing Code: Section P-121.0 Means of Appeal.
C. 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code: Section R-107 Right
of Appeal.
D. 1993 BOCA National Mechanical Code: Section M-121.0 Means of Appeal.
E. 1993 BOCA National Property and Maintenance Code: Section PM-111.0
Means of Appeal.
The Borough of Zelienople may from time to time, by resolution,
adopt, change, alter or amend various articles or sections of the
1993 BOCA National Building Code, the 1999 National Electrical Code,
the 1993 BOCA National Plumbing Code, the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family
Dwelling Code, Appendix C of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ling
Code, the 1993 BOCA National Property and Maintenance Code and the
1993 BOCA Mechanical Code, as the Borough Council deems appropriate
or necessary for the administration of this article.
The Borough Council may from time to time, by resolution, adopt,
change, alter or amend fees for any permits, services, certificates
or inspections authorized by this article.
No structure, whether residential, commercial or industrial,
shall be occupied until a certificate of occupancy is issued by the
building officials designated by the Borough Council in accordance
with this article. No such certificate of occupancy shall be issued
until all inspections as required by this article have been completed
and all associated fees have been paid to the Borough. The owner of
any property for which a permit is required, along with the applicant
for said permit, shall both be liable to the Borough for any such
fees for permits and inspections.
The property owner or permit applicant may be required to submit
a construction plan and property plan showing the improvements requested.
These plans shall be for information purposes only for the Borough,
and the issuance of any permit after such submission does not constitute
approval of any plan so submitted, which plans are deemed to be solely
for the purpose of assisting the Borough during inspections.
In the event the Borough Zoning Ordinance (Chapter
280), Subdivision Ordinance (Chapter
240) or any other ordinance of the Borough, state or federal government provides for a more strict standard than provided in this article, the stricter standard shall apply.
If at any time the building officials determine that a property
owner, contractor, permit applicant or any other person connected
with the construction, installation or renovation has violated any
provision of this article or standards established by the 1993 BOCA
National Building Code, the 1999 National Electrical Code, the 1993
BOCA National Plumbing Code, the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ling
Code, Appendix C of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code,
Appendix F of the 1992 CABO One- and Two-Family Dwelling Code, the
1993 BOCA National Property Maintenance Code and the 1993 BOCA Mechanical
Code or any amendments thereto, the said building officials shall
have the right to suspend any permit issued, issue a stop-work order,
deny an occupancy permit and refuse to permit any further construction
or installation.
In the event of a violation of any provisions of this article,
no certificate of occupancy shall be issued for any such structure
determined to be in violation by the building official, and no such
structure shall be occupied by any person until such violation is
abated.
The Borough may proceed with an action of law and/or in equity
to enforce the provisions of this article, and the proceeding with
such legal action shall not prohibit the Borough from seeking to impose
other penalties prescribed by this article nor from suspending construction
or issuing a stop-work order as provided for in this article.
In addition to or separate from the action set forth in the above §
115-10, any person violating this article or any part thereof may be charged and shall, upon conviction before a Magisterial District Judge of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, pay a fine of not less than $100 nor more than $300 and, in default of the payment of such fine, shall be imprisoned for a period of not more than 10 days in the Butler County Prison. Each day a violation continues shall be deemed to be a separate offense and shall be subject, in all respects, to the same penalties imposed for each day's offense.
